However, little is known about the learning effect of visual working memory training and its generalization to other stimuli and tasks.Methods: In the present study, we utilized a delayed match-to-sample task to measure the working memory of faces and houses. Subjects were trained ten days on this task and were tested on the same task and a memory span task before and after the training.Results: The results showed that training significantly increased the accuracy of visual working memory. More importantly, such a learning effect could partly transfer to a visual working memory task with different stimuli. However, the learning effect may not transfer to a memory span task.Conclusion: Our findings demonstrate that training might influence the common processing of different stimuli in a visual working memory task.Keywords: training, visual working memory, transfer, face perception
